    I met up with a friend here on their recommendation. There was a wait for a table and it may have been longer if we were not on the reservations list. It took about 35 minutes to be seated. The waitress quickly gave us menus and explained the foox items and how everything was cooked fresh. I ordered the bbq platter with smoked fried chicken and brisket. My sides were cornbread, greens and baked beans. The meal quickly arrived. The meat was great.. There are 3 types of homemade sauces on the table, sweet, spicy snd a combination. The brisket wss cooked well and had a good taste. The chicken was also good and had a nice smoky flavor. The greens were cooked well and seasoned great. The baked beans were also cooked from scratch. The cornbresd was a nice big slice. It had jalapeños added as a nice touch. The waiter was very attentive and the meal was good and flavorful. I plan on checking this spot out again.

    Went here for the 3rd time. Most of us didn't want ribs as they saw burgers and pizza. So we shared pizza and a slab. The slabs are market rate so in Oct 2025 it was ~$27 for half/$38 for full. Full meaty ribs. They had the texture of par boiled which isn't my thing but one of us liked. The beans were a no for all of us though they did have some brads meat but not enough. Now the grits were so good. I mean so much that I'd come back for those alone! And i wasn't the only one. The pizza was good. We wanted dessert but they were out of their banana cream pie. We had a sundae but that was vanilla ice cream & chocolate syrup. I'd pass on that. The service is always good. We had Jill today. They handle groups well and the menu will work for almost everyone except vegans. We spent about $75 for us, no drinks,tip,tax which we thought was ok and had leftovers
